What Cobalt does
Cobalt, associated with Cobalt Labs, Inc., helped define pentest-as-a-service: customers scope an engagement through a platform, matched vetted testers conduct the assessment collaboratively, and findings arrive in structured reports with remediation tracking and retest options. The model compresses logistics that traditionally delayed assessments and widens access to competent human testing for companies without in-house red teams.
Reports integrate with compliance narratives, and the collaborative platform keeps communication between customer and testers unusually fluid. For periodic, professionally conducted human assessment, the offering is coherent and well regarded, and nothing on this page disputes the value of skilled testers.
Where the scopes differ
Even excellent testers examine the system as it exists during the engagement. Supabase applications change on every merge, and authorisation posture changes with them: policies rewritten, protections dropped, grants widened, keys redistributed. Findings therefore begin decaying the moment the next migration lands.
Within the window itself, testers probing PostgREST must infer authorisation semantics from responses where filtered and empty results are identical, spending scarce hours reconstructing facts a catalog query states plainly. RowShield removes reconstruction: it reads definitions, applies rules such as RLS_DISABLED, ANON_TABLE_READABLE and SERVICE_ROLE_KEY_EXPOSED mechanically, and repeats the process with every change thereafter.

Where Cobalt is the right choice
Some assurances require people. Customer contracts and audit programmes frequently specify a recent human-led penetration test, and Cobalt satisfies such requirements credibly. Business-logic flaws, chained abuses and creative misuse resist rule engines and reward skilled curiosity, which its tester community supplies.
The concession is structural, not qualitative: engagement-shaped assurance cannot police ongoing change, however talented its authors.
